  elektronische bauelemente SBL20H60R voltage 60 v 20.0 amp low vf schottky barrier rectifiers 1-aug-2011 rev. a page 1 of 2 http://www.secosgmbh.com/ any changes of specification will not be informed individually. 1 2 3 rohs compliant product a suffix of ?-c? specifies halogen free features z super low forward voltage drop z low reverse current z high current capability z high reliability z high surge current capability z epitaxial construction mechanical data z case: molded plastic z epoxy: ul94v-0 rate flame retardant z lead: lead solder able per mil-std-202 method 208 guaranteed z polarity: as marked z mounting position: any z weight: 1.93 grams (approximate) maximum ratings and electrical characteristics (rating 25 c ambient temperature unless otherwise specified. sing le phase half wave, 60hz, resistive or inductive load. for capacitive load, de-rate current by 20%.) parameter symbol rating unit maximum recurrent peak reverse voltage v rrm 60 v working peak reverse voltage v rsm 60 v maximum dc blocking voltage v dc 60 v per leg 10 maximum average forward rectified current per device i f 20 a peak forward surge current, 8.3 ms single half sine-wave superimposed on rated load (jedec method) i fsm 200 a i f = 10 a, t a = 25 c, per leg 0.57 maximum instantaneous forward voltage i f = 10 a, t a = 125 c, per leg v f 0.52 v t a = 25 c 0.12 maximum dc reverse current at rated dc blocking voltage 3 t a = 100 c i r 10 ma typical junction capacitance 1 c j 620 pf typical thermal resistance 2 r jc 4 c /w voltage rate of chance (rated v r ) dv / dt 10000 v / s operating temperature range t j t j -50 ~ +150 c storage temperature range t stg t stg -50 ~ +150 c notes: 1. measured at 1mhz and applied reverse voltage of 5.0v d.c. 2. thermal resistance junction to case. 3. pulse test: 300 s pulse width, 1% duty cycle. millimete r millimete r ref. min. max. ref. min. max. a 14.22 16.51 j 0.7 1.78 b 9.65 10.67 k 0.38 1.02 c 12.50 14.75 l 2.39 2.69 d 3.56 4.90 m 2.50 3.43 e 0.51 1.45 n 3.10 4.09 f 2.03 2.92 o 8.38 9.65 g 0.31 0.76 p 0.89 1.45 h3.5 4.5 to-220 dimensions in millimeters a m p j k l l g f b n d e o c h
